Watonga is a city in Blaine County, Oklahoma. It is the county seat of Blaine County. Local restaurants include Ivy"S Restaurant, Noble House Restaurant, Carrillo's Restaurant, and Hi-De-Ho Cafe.

Roman Nose State Park Lodge
Roman Nose State Park, named after a Cheyenne chief, is one of the original seven Oklahoma state parks.
